Hop Protocol

Hop Protocol is a multi-chain token bridge focused on fast, low-cost transfers between Ethereum mainnet and major Layer 2 networks. Using bonders who front liquidity for near-instant transfers and later settle on-chain, Hop delivers significantly faster bridging than canonical bridges requiring long withdrawal periods. As HyperEVM grows alongside the broader L2 ecosystem, Hop provides a seamless corridor for users moving USDC, ETH, and other tokens from Arbitrum, Optimism, and Polygon into Hyperliquid. Its liquidity pool model allows LPs to earn fees by providing AMM liquidity for bridged assets, creating a self-sustaining ecosystem. Hop's architecture eliminates the trust assumptions of wrapped tokens by using a native AMM approach where the bridge asset is always redeemable 1:1 with the canonical token on the destination chain, providing strong security guarantees for users bridging significant capital into the Hyperliquid ecosystem.

Trail of Bits

Trail of Bits is one of the most respected cybersecurity research and consulting firms in the blockchain space, providing world-class smart contract audits and security research for protocols building on HyperEVM and other EVM chains. With an interdisciplinary team including cryptographers and EVM experts, Trail of Bits applies rigorous static analysis, fuzzing with Echidna, formal verification with Manticore, and manual code review to identify vulnerabilities that automated tools miss. Trail of Bits has audited some of the most complex protocols in DeFi, including cryptographic libraries, cross-chain bridges, and lending protocols—all relevant to the infrastructure being built on Hyperliquid. Their public security research and open-source tooling (Slither, Echidna, Medusa) benefit the entire HyperEVM developer community beyond their paid audit clients, raising the security baseline of the entire ecosystem through freely available tools and research.
